Understanding God's Sovereignty in Uncertain Times
Understanding God's sovereignty in uncertain times is a comforting and complex doctrine that addresses the heart of a believer's trust in God. This truth reminds us that God is not only all-powerful but also all-knowing, working everything out according to His good purpose. Paul writes in Romans 8:28 that "God works all things together for good to them that love God, to them who are the called according to his purpose." This verse underscores the comprehensive nature of God's sovereignty, where even in uncertain times, He is actively working to bring about good for those who are His.
In uncertain times, the doctrine of God's sovereignty is a rock upon which believers can stand, knowing that their lives are not subject to chance or fate. It reminds us that God's control is not limited to the grand scheme of history but extends to the smallest details of our lives. This understanding does not diminish human responsibility but rather underscores the reality that our choices and actions are part of the larger tapestry that God is weaving.
The misconception that God's sovereignty diminishes human freedom or makes God responsible for evil is a common misunderstanding. However, Scripture teaches that God's sovereignty and human responsibility coexist, and that God is not the author of sin. Instead, He uses even the evil intentions of men to achieve His righteous purposes, as seen in the story of Joseph and his brothers. This profound truth should lead believers to trust in God's goodness and wisdom, even when circumstances seem uncertain or overwhelming, and to find comfort in the knowledge that He is always working for their good.
